For the international students with no or meagre scholarships - please decide carefully before spending $200k.

I am a current student in USA & i can see very clearly how international students are struggling to get any meaningful internship/offers. A lot of career options like Investment banking, many boutique firms & tech companies are literally shut down for international students who need sponsorships.

Situation is gonna be severe in coming years - due to post war recession, AI & conservatism in USA. Political apathy towards immigrant can be felt & racism is on rise.

If you are having full ride or have savings of like $150k+ or belong to a rich family - you may still think but others the path is really very difficult.

From this year at Yale SOM & other top colleges - investment banking companies didn’t sponsored international students.
All the boutiques & startups too the same.

It boils down to either MBB or large tech companies - which has now increased competition. With AI, a lot of tech companies are also hiring less for entry level - they are clubbing roles & wanting experienced people. So changing industry is also difficult.

Also i have also heard there are stricter restrictions with current H1B visa - like you can’t go outside for specified months/years.
